Journalists to Jam Tuesday at NAB2005

NAB has added a session to replace the FCC Chairman’s Breakfast on Tuesday at the show. FCC Chairman Kevin Martin had to cancel his appearance due to the death of his father.
NAB has added “The Fourth Estate Unplugged,” a breakfast featuring media journalists Sam Donaldson, Jeff Greenfield and Charles Osgood on Tuesday at 7:30 a.m.
NAB President/CEO Eddie Fritts will moderate what the association says will be a free-wheeling discussion of broadcast topics, including the First Amendment and the future of broadcast television news.
Donaldson is a veteran White House news correspondent for ABC radio and television news. Greenfield, a former ABC News correspondent, is a frequent contributor to the “Imus In The Morning” and a CNN commentator. Osgood is anchor of CBS Radio’s syndicated “The Osgood File,” and host of “CBS News Sunday Morning.”
